Car totally destroyed by fire in Greenace

A CAR caught fire on Roberts Rd, Greenacre, Friday morning but no one was inside.

Fire and Rescue NSW, who attended the incident, said it took their crew from Lakemba around 50 minutes to douse the flames which engulfed the vehicle.

The fire occurred near the McDonalds cafe and blocked off two lanes of traffic while the firefighters fought the blaze.

“Our crew arrived at the scene around 6am and found the car well alight,” a FRNSW spokeswoman said.

“The car was totally destroyed but no one was inside.

“Two lanes were closed to traffic for some time due to the fire.”
